This chicken poke bowl is a great alternative when sushi-grade fish isn't in the budget. I love it because it's quick, easy and inexpensive. While it's not a traditional poke recipe, the chicken still rocks in this bowl. -Emily Cresta, Oxford, Ohio

Steps:
- Cook rice according to package directions. Meanwhile, in a resealable jar, whisk vinegar and sugar until dissolved; add red onion. Seal and refrigerate 30 minutes or up to 2 weeks. In a small bowl, stir together mayonnaise and chili sauce; refrigerate, covered, until serving., In a large skillet or wok, toss chicken, soy sauce, sesame oil and honey. Cook and stir over medium-low heat until chicken is heated through, 5-7 minutes. To serve, divide rice among 4 serving bowls. Top with chicken mixture, avocado, cucumber, sprouts, pickled onions, spicy mayonnaise and, if desired, green onions and sesame seeds.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 539 calories, Fat 26g fat (5g saturated fat), Cholesterol 64mg cholesterol, Sodium 606mg sodium, Carbohydrate 49g carbohydrate (4g sugars, Fiber 4g fiber), Protein 25g protein.
